Why You Need Professional Alignment for Your Vehicle's Performance

Regarding achieving optimal vehicle performance, wheel alignment plays a crucial role. Accurate alignment ensures your vehicle's safety and handling perform optimally. You need to understand essential automotive aspects, such as tire wear, fuel efficiency, and steering precision. Correct wheel alignment methods involve setting the wheel positions to the manufacturer's specifications, addressing camber, caster, and toe. These modifications reduce uneven tire wear and extend tire longevity. Misaligned wheels can cause your vehicle to veer, requiring constant steering corrections, which decreases fuel efficiency. By utilizing accurate wheel alignment techniques, you improve the vehicle's handling and minimize the strain on suspension components. In fact, professional alignment enhances driving comfort and provides your vehicle operates at peak performance.

Main Reasons for Wheel Alignment Issues

As you drive, you might spot your vehicle veering off center or tires wearing unevenly, which typically suggests wheel misalignment. This problem often results from issues within the wheel suspension system. Components like control arms, tie rods, and struts could become deteriorated, putting your wheels out of alignment. Moreover, your driving habits are a significant factor. Regularly hitting potholes, curbs, or speed bumps at excessive speeds may change the alignment settings. Even minor collisions can impact the suspension geometry. Moreover, skipping routine maintenance checks can exacerbate these concerns, leading wheels to deviate from their intended path. The Connection Between Wheel Alignment and Tire Durability

Correct wheel alignment is essential for maximizing tire life and guaranteeing optimal vehicle performance. When wheels are properly aligned, the tires make optimal contact with the road, minimizing uneven wear. Poor alignment causes issues like camber, caster, and toe irregularities, resulting in accelerated tire degradation. Monitor tire pressure consistently, as wrong pressure can worsen misalignment effects. Appropriate tire pressure ensures that the tires wear uniformly and keep proper traction. Furthermore, seasonal maintenance is essential; alignment should be inspected as temperatures change, influencing tire pressure and alignment settings. By addressing wheel alignment promptly, you increase tire lifespan, optimize fuel efficiency, and strengthen overall vehicle safety. How Much Time Does a Standard Wheel Alignment Usually Require?

When you're thinking about wheel alignment, you're probably wondering about the time required. Typically, a wheel alignment process takes approximately an hour. This standard service involves adjusting the positioning of your wheels to match the manufacturer's specifications. During this process, technicians utilize advanced equipment to measure toe, camber, and caster angles. Should you have additional issues, like worn suspension parts, it could require a bit longer. This service is essential for peak vehicle performance.

What's the Recommended Frequency for Wheel Alignment Checks?

Interested in how often to schedule wheel alignment service? As a rule of thumb, they should be completed every 6,000 to 10,000 miles or yearly, whichever comes first. Consider getting an immediate alignment if you observe signs of misalignment like tires wearing unevenly, vehicle drift, or an off-center steering wheel. Scheduled alignment maintenance helps maintain ideal vehicle performance, extends tire life, and improves safety. Stay proactive to resolve alignment issues before they lead to major expenses.

Can I Perform Wheel Alignment at Home?

There are a few home-based approaches for wheel alignment, though they don't match the precision of professional equipment. Start with a tape measure to verify toe alignment, taking measurements from the tire's front and rear edges. Modify the tie rods based on measurements. To measure camber, use a magnetic gauge on the wheel hub. It's important to verify your vehicle is on an even surface. While these methods can address minor alignment issues, visiting a professional guarantees the best results.
